The most frequent reason users search for this tool is the Waste Ink Pad Counter overflow. When this happens, the printer stops printing entirely. Other common uses include:

Check the boxes next to Main pad counter and Platen pad counter . Click the Check button to read the current percentage and point accumulation.

The adjustment program Epson L3150 is a specialized software tool developed by Epson to diagnose and adjust the printer's settings. It's designed to resolve common issues such as paper jams, print head problems, and ink system errors. The program communicates with the printer to perform various adjustments, ensuring that it operates smoothly and efficiently.
